Inspection/Report History

Where possible, ChildcareCenter provides inspection reports as a service to families. This information is deemed reliable but is not guaranteed. We encourage families to contact the daycare provider directly with any questions or concerns. Reports can also be verified with your local daycare licensing office.

Report Date Report Type Report Status
2025-09-03 Licensing Review - See Violation(s)
Violation Category: Minnesota Statutes, section 142B.54, subdivision 2, paragraph (e) and Minnesota Rules, part 9503.0140, subpart 17 - Facility Minnesota Statutes, section 142B.01, subdivision 27 and Minnesota Rules, part 9503.0045, subpart 1, item A - Program Practices Minnesota Statutes, section 142B.65, subdivision 4 and Minnesota Rules, part 9503.0120, subpart D - Staff Training Minnesota Statutes, section 142B.65, subdivision 5 and Minnesota Rules, part 9503.0120, subpart D - Staff Training Minnesota Statutes, section 142B.65, subdivision 9 - Staff Training
Violation Description: Facility: Hazardous objects were accessible to children. Program Practices: Staff did not supervise the children at all times. Staff Training: The program did not comply with first aid training requirements. Staff Training: The program did not comply with CPR training requirements. Staff Training: All staff did not complete ongoing training requirements.
